Version Control with Git

Git is a version control system that allows developers to track changes in their source code. It is critical for maintaining project history and collaboration.

Key concepts include:

  • Repositories: A repository is a storage space for project files, which can be local or hosted on platforms like GitHub.
  • Commits: Developers create commits to record changes. Each commit provides a snapshot of the codebase at a specific moment.
  • Branches: Branching allows multiple developers to work on different features simultaneously without impacting the main code.

Mastering Git ensures smooth collaboration and efficient code management.

The Importance of Writing Clean Code

Clean code is key to maintainability and collaboration. It should be easy to read, understand, and modify.

Some best practices include:

  • Consistent Naming Conventions: Use descriptive names for functions and variables to clarify their purpose.
  • Commenting: Well-placed comments can provide context but should not replace clear code.
  • Modularity: Break code into smaller, reusable functions or modules to promote clarity and reduce complexity.

Adopting these practices leads to more efficient development and easier onboarding of new team members.

Building a Portfolio through Projects

Developers should focus on building projects that showcase their skills. This can include web applications, mobile apps, or data analysis projects. Unique and creative project ideas can set a portfolio apart. For example, creating a personal blog, a weather app, or a simple game can demonstrate technical abilities.

Using GitHub to host these projects is vital. It allows potential employers and collaborators to view the code quality and thought processes behind the projects. Developers should document their code well and include README files that explain the project, setup instructions, and usage examples. This not only helps others understand the work but also reflects professionalism.
